summaryrefslogtreecommitdiffstats
path: root/src/core/arm/dynarmic
diff options
context:
space:
mode:
authorFernando Sahmkow <fsahmkow27@gmail.com>2021-06-20 20:40:02 +0200
committerFernando Sahmkow <fsahmkow27@gmail.com>2021-06-20 20:40:02 +0200
commit22985084655e7422f0093291fa5445c0bbfa8c22 (patch)
tree68710f716b76109581f152b9166d0ea50cff8123 /src/core/arm/dynarmic
parentMerge pull request #6494 from lat9nq/mingw-fix-fastmem (diff)
downloadyuzu-22985084655e7422f0093291fa5445c0bbfa8c22.tar
yuzu-22985084655e7422f0093291fa5445c0bbfa8c22.tar.gz
yuzu-22985084655e7422f0093291fa5445c0bbfa8c22.tar.bz2
yuzu-22985084655e7422f0093291fa5445c0bbfa8c22.tar.lz
yuzu-22985084655e7422f0093291fa5445c0bbfa8c22.tar.xz
yuzu-22985084655e7422f0093291fa5445c0bbfa8c22.tar.zst
yuzu-22985084655e7422f0093291fa5445c0bbfa8c22.zip
Diffstat (limited to 'src/core/arm/dynarmic')
-rw-r--r--src/core/arm/dynarmic/arm_dynarmic_32.cpp3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/core/arm/dynarmic/arm_dynarmic_32.cpp b/src/core/arm/dynarmic/arm_dynarmic_32.cpp
index c8f6dc765..f871f7bf4 100644
--- a/src/core/arm/dynarmic/arm_dynarmic_32.cpp
+++ b/src/core/arm/dynarmic/arm_dynarmic_32.cpp
@@ -186,6 +186,9 @@ std::shared_ptr<Dynarmic::A32::Jit> ARM_Dynarmic_32::MakeJit(Common::PageTable*
if (Settings::values.cpuopt_unsafe_reduce_fp_error.GetValue()) {
config.optimizations |= Dynarmic::OptimizationFlag::Unsafe_ReducedErrorFP;
}
+ if (Settings::values.cpuopt_unsafe_ignore_standard_fpcr.GetValue()) {
+ config.optimizations |= Dynarmic::OptimizationFlag::Unsafe_IgnoreStandardFPCRValue;
+ }
if (Settings::values.cpuopt_unsafe_inaccurate_nan.GetValue()) {
config.optimizations |= Dynarmic::OptimizationFlag::Unsafe_InaccurateNaN;
}